I have an old Sony Handycam CCDTRV238 which takes Hi8 tapes and would like to put them on my laptop.
Any help with what leads I need?
I have an AV lead with the camera but the laptop is quite new so it really only has USB ports. Any help would be much appreciated!

That camcorder only appears to have composite video, so a simple USB capture device should work well enough.
